The Executive Development Programme in Robotic Creativity Innovation focuses on developing professionals who can lead the way in integrating robotics and creativity to drive business growth. This 3D pie chart highlights the current job market trends in the UK, featuring primary roles in the robotics industry. In the vibrant field of Robotic Creativity Innovation, Robotics Engineers lead the pack with 35% of the market share, demonstrating the high demand for experts capable of designing, maintaining, and innovating robotic systems. Robotics Software Developers follow closely behind, accounting for 25% of the sector, as their expertise in programming and software solutions remains crucial for robotics integration. Automation Technicians specialize in building and maintaining automated machinery, making up 20% of the robotics job market. Meanwhile, the role of Robotics Technicians, responsible for installing, maintaining, and repairing robots, accounts for 15% of the industry. Lastly, Robotics Data Analysts, who focus on using data to improve the performance of robotic systems, represent 5% of the sector. This niche role is expected to grow as data-driven decision-making becomes increasingly important in the industry.
